What Causes Adenoid?

hello Doctor! my son is 3.5 years old. he suffers from from cough and cold very frequently i.e once in 2 months. he is alsovery restless. pediatricians suggested that he has some allergic problem and suggested to protect him from dust. as he has started going to school now it seems to be quite imposible to avoid dust. recently we visited a homeopathy doctor who advised us for an x-ray of the nasopharyngeal area. the x-ray revealed that he is having adenoid which is suppresing the airway column obstructing the flow of oxygen to the brain which can be associated to his restlessness. my query is whether it is any inborn structural deformity, is it something really very serious..

Pediatrician 's  Response
hi, no it is not an inborn deformity. adenoids are normal tissue located in the nasopharynx which gets enlarged in children with allergic disorders causing obstruction to air flow during breathing causing nose block, snoring , disturbed sleep, day time sleepiness, irritability etc. it can be treated by avoiding the allergen (dust in your child) and by using antiallergic drugs. if it becomes very troublesome can be treated surgically. you should see a ENr cT specialist to see what form of treatment ur child requires. thank you
